Description

Dip your toes into the waters of functional nutrition, or food as medicine!  Discover what functional nutrition is and how to apply the principles to orthopedic-related conditions including osteoarthritis, weight optimization before joint replacement surgery, fractures, osteoporosis, and concussions.  Evidence backed supplements to help manage orthopedic conditions will be discussed.  You will develop effective methods to introduce functional nutrition topics to patients in a standard office visit and learn techniques to overcome common barriers.  Kristin Schmidtgall MPH, MPAS, PA-C, will share real life examples from her own orthopedic practice and the patient transformations that have taken place!

Kristin Schmidtgall, MPH, PA-C, is a practicing physician assistant, starting in family practice and then focused on orthopedics. Nutrition has become a passion of hers, as she continued her nutrition coursework as an undergrad at Cornell University and in her Master of Public Health at the University of Michigan. Kristin then became a Certified Functional Nutrition Informed Professional and has been sparked to incorporate ‘food as medicine’ in her orthopedic practice. She is excited to share the resulting significant improvements in patient outcomes with other clinicians!

Objectives

  1. Evaluate how food can be used as medicine for various orthopedic ailments. 
  2. Develop functional nutrition recommendations for patients with osteoarthritis.  
  3. Plan food recommendations to reduce weight before total joint replacement surgery becomes necessary.  
  4. Incorporate brief functional nutrition discussions within clinical visits.
